The Nauticam TTL Flash Trigger is an ideal accessory for the still
photographer. This hotshoe mounted optical flash trigger provides
automatic TTL Flash when used with Inon S-TTL and Sea & Sea DS-TTL
Strobes connected by fiber optic cables. The TTL trigger also offers
manual triggering, including rear curtain sync, with any compatible
slave strobe.
Accurate automatic TTL flash exposure has been a favorite feature of Nauticam photographers using cameras with pop up flashes, and the TTL Trigger unlocks this feature set in the NA-5DMKIV Housing. Powered by a single Canon NB-13L rechargeable battery, the TTL Trigger provides approximately 150 full power flashes.
New in NA-5DMKIV, a window allows the flash trigger status LED to be clearly viewed, and the housing features a power button. This LED provides important status info, and the power button allows the trigger to be activated underwater.
Optical TTL Strobe Compatibility:
Inon S-2000, D-2000, and Z-240
Sea & Sea YS-D1, YS-D2, and YS-01

Construction: | Body: PC+ABS |
Dimensions: | Approx. 70 x 47 x 28mm |
Weight: | Approx. 44g (w/ batteries installed) |
Battery: | Canon NB-13L x1pc |
Operation: | TTL or Manual |
Flash Capacity: | Approx. 1000times |
Compatible housings: | NA-1DXII, 1DX, 5DIV, 5DSR, 5DMKIII, 6D, 7DMKII, 80D, 70D |
Compatible strobes: | INON: Z240 type 4, D2000 type 4, S2000
Sea&Sea: YS-D2, YS-D1, YS-01 |
